diff options
Diffstat (limited to 'modules/openxr/extensions/openxr_extension_wrapper_extension.h')
-rw-r--r-- | modules/openxr/extensions/openxr_extension_wrapper_extension.h |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/modules/openxr/extensions/openxr_extension_wrapper_extension.h b/modules/openxr/extensions/openxr_extension_wrapper_extension.h index e37853903b..5cdf288c93 100644 --- a/modules/openxr/extensions/openxr_extension_wrapper_extension.h +++ b/modules/openxr/extensions/openxr_extension_wrapper_extension.h @@ -121,15 +121,17 @@ public: GDVIRTUAL1R(bool, _on_event_polled, GDExtensionConstPtr<void>); - virtual void *set_viewport_composition_layer_and_get_next_pointer(const XrCompositionLayerBaseHeader *p_layer, Dictionary p_property_values, void *p_next_pointer) override; + virtual void *set_viewport_composition_layer_and_get_next_pointer(const XrCompositionLayerBaseHeader *p_layer, const Dictionary &p_property_values, void *p_next_pointer) override; virtual void on_viewport_composition_layer_destroyed(const XrCompositionLayerBaseHeader *p_layer) override; virtual void get_viewport_composition_layer_extension_properties(List<PropertyInfo> *p_property_list) override; virtual Dictionary get_viewport_composition_layer_extension_property_defaults() override; + virtual void *set_android_surface_swapchain_create_info_and_get_next_pointer(const Dictionary &p_property_values, void *p_next_pointer) override; GDVIRTUAL3R(uint64_t, _set_viewport_composition_layer_and_get_next_pointer, GDExtensionConstPtr<void>, Dictionary, GDExtensionPtr<void>); GDVIRTUAL1(_on_viewport_composition_layer_destroyed, GDExtensionConstPtr<void>); GDVIRTUAL0R(TypedArray<Dictionary>, _get_viewport_composition_layer_extension_properties); GDVIRTUAL0R(Dictionary, _get_viewport_composition_layer_extension_property_defaults); + GDVIRTUAL2R(uint64_t, _set_android_surface_swapchain_create_info_and_get_next_pointer, Dictionary, GDExtensionPtr<void>); Ref<OpenXRAPIExtension> get_openxr_api(); |